আমি সম্প্রতি আপনার সাথে কথা বলছিলাম টার্মিনাল থেকে ইউএসবি ফর্ম্যাট করতে এই প্রোগ্রামের মধ্যেও কোনও প্রোগ্রামের সহায়তা ছাড়াই আমি কীভাবে কোনও ডিভাইসকে নিম্ন স্তরের বিন্যাসে যুক্ত করতে চাই স্টোরেজ।
El সংক্ষেপে নিম্ন-স্তরের ফর্ম্যাটটি হ'ল কিছু ডিভাইসকে নতুন হিসাবে ছেড়ে যাওয়াআমার অর্থ এই নয় যে তারা যখন এটি প্রথম অর্জন করেছিল তখন এটি পুনরুদ্ধার করা হবে এবং আবার শুরু হবে, বরং সময়ের সাথে সাথে স্টোরেজ ডিভাইসে লিখিত ডেটা আবারও লেখা হবে।
আমি যখন পুনর্লিখনের বিষয়ে কথা বলি তখন তা হ'ল, যখন আমরা কোনও ডিভাইস ফর্ম্যাট করি তখন আমাদের ডেটা পুরোপুরি মুছে ফেলা হয় না, কেবলমাত্র কিছু সেক্টরই মুছে ফেলা হয় এবং সমস্ত কিছু নয়, এইভাবে কিছু তথ্য পুনরুদ্ধার করাও সম্ভব।
ডেটা সুরক্ষা freaks জন্য, এই পদ্ধতিটি এমন কিছু যা তারা সাধারণত হিসাবে ব্যবহার করা উচিত আমরা যা করতে যাচ্ছি তা হ'ল আমাদের ডিভাইসের সমস্ত সেক্টর পুনরায় লিখতে.
যদিও এটি এমন কিছু যা অপ্রচলিত হিসাবে বিবেচিত হয়, তবুও এটি একটি দুর্দান্ত ফাংশন যা আমাদের চূড়ান্ত ক্ষেত্রে সহায়তা করে example
প্রথম জিনিসটি হ'ল আমাদের অবশ্যই আমাদের ডিভাইসটি কোন মাউন্টিং পয়েন্টে সনাক্ত করতে হবে যার ভিত্তিতে আমরা এটিকে নিম্ন-স্তরের ফর্ম্যাট দেব।
আমরা এটির সাথে এটি খুঁজে পেতে পারি:
lsblk
এখন থেকে আমি দায়বদ্ধ নই কারণ আপনি অবশ্যই কোন ডিভাইসে কাজ করছেন সে সম্পর্কে আপনার অবশ্যই নিশ্চিত হওয়া উচিত, আপনার যদি একাধিক সংযোগ থাকে তবে আমি আপনাকে প্রস্তাব দিই যে আপনি কেবল সেই ডিভাইসটি রেখেছেন যা আপনি সংযুক্ত অবস্থায় কাজ করছেন,
প্রথমে ডিভাইসটি সংযুক্ত না করে কমান্ডটি চালান এবং তারপরে এটি চালান, তবে ডিভাইসটির সাথে সংযুক্ত হয়ে, আপনি এভাবে খুঁজে পাবেন যে কোনটি মাউন্ট পয়েন্ট যুক্ত হয়েছিল।
এই ক্ষেত্রে আমাদের অবশ্যই আমাদের হার্ড ড্রাইভ বাতিল করা উচিতকমান্ড প্রদর্শিত তালিকার মধ্যে আমার ক্ষেত্রে আমার আছে:
/dev/sda1 /dev/sda2 /dev/sda3 /dev/sda4 /dev/sdb1 /dev/sdb2 /dev/sdc
আমার ক্ষেত্রে আমার সাথে দুটি হার্ড ড্রাইভ সংযুক্ত রয়েছে, যা আপনার ক্ষেত্রে / dev / sda এর সাথে আমার সিস্টেমের চারটি পার্টিশন / বুট / হোম / রুট / অদলবদল এবং / dev / sdb এর ক্ষেত্রে দুটি পার্টিশন রয়েছে যেখানে আমার আছে আমার ব্যক্তিগত তথ্য
এইভাবে আমি জানি / ডিভ / এসডিসি আমার ডিভাইস যা আমি এটিকে নিম্ন স্তরের ফর্ম্যাট দেব।
এখন আমি শুধু করতে হবে সুপার ব্যবহারকারীর অনুমতি নিয়ে টার্মিনালে নিম্নলিখিত কমান্ডটি চালান:
dd if=/dev/zero of=/dev/sdX
যেখানে / ডিভ / এসডিএক্স হ'ল মাউন্ট পয়েন্ট যা আমি ফর্ম্যাট করব।
আমার ক্ষেত্রে কমান্ডটি এরকম হবে:
dd if=/dev/zero of=/dev/sdc
এই ধরণের ফর্ম্যাটটিতে একটু সময় লাগে বলে এখন আমাদের কেবল কিছুক্ষণ অপেক্ষা করতে হবে।
অবশেষে, ডিভাইসের কোনও ফর্ম্যাট থাকবে না তাই আমাদের অবশ্যই এটি এটিকে দিতে হবে, আমার ক্ষেত্রে আমি এটি একটি ফ্যাট 32 ফর্ম্যাটটি দেব
sudo mkfs.vfat -F 32 /dev/sdc -I
এবং এটি সব।